如何在欧易平台提高订单执行速度
在加密货币交易中,订单执行速度至关重要。更快的执行速度意味着你能以更接近期望的价格成交,从而最大化利润并减少滑点。在欧易(OKX)平台上,有多种方法可以提高订单的执行速度,本文将详细介绍这些方法。
一、 理解订单类型与执行优先级
欧易(OKX)等加密货币交易所提供多种订单类型,每种订单类型都具有不同的执行机制和优先级。深入理解这些差异是优化交易策略、提高订单执行速度、并最终提升交易效率的基础。
-
限价单 (Limit Order):
限价单允许交易者设定一个期望的买入或卖出价格。订单只有在市场价格达到或优于(低于买入价或高于卖出价)设定的价格时才会被执行。
优势: 交易者可以精确控制成交价格,避免以不利的价格成交。适用于对价格敏感的交易者,以及在特定价格点位进行交易的策略。
劣势: 如果市场价格快速波动,订单可能长时间无法成交,甚至最终无法成交,错失交易机会。限价单的执行速度相对较慢,因为它依赖于市场价格达到预设水平。
适用场景: 适合不着急成交,追求更优价格的交易者。例如,在预期的支撑位挂买单,或在预期的阻力位挂卖单。
-
市价单 (Market Order):
市价单以当前市场上最佳的可用价格立即买入或卖出。交易所会撮合市场上的最优买单或卖单,以尽快完成交易。
优势: 订单几乎可以立即成交,执行速度最快,保证成交的确定性。
劣势: 成交价格可能会高于或低于交易者的预期,尤其是在市场深度不足或波动剧烈时,可能出现较大的滑点。滑点是指实际成交价格与下单时看到的价格之间的差异。
适用场景: 适合对价格不敏感,追求快速成交的交易者。例如,紧急平仓或需要立即参与市场行情时。
-
止盈止损单 (Stop-Limit/Stop-Market Order):
止盈止损单是一种条件订单,旨在限制损失或锁定利润。它包含一个触发价格(止损价或止盈价)。当市场价格达到该触发价格时,订单会被激活,并转换为指定的订单类型(限价单或市价单)执行。
止盈单: 设定高于当前市场价格的触发价格,当价格上涨到该水平时,触发卖出订单,锁定利润。
止损单: 设定低于当前市场价格的触发价格,当价格下跌到该水平时,触发卖出订单,限制损失。
Stop-Limit 止盈止损单: 激活后,转换为限价单执行。执行速度取决于激活后的市场价格是否能满足限价条件。可以更精确地控制成交价格,但可能无法成交。
Stop-Market 止盈止损单: 激活后,转换为市价单执行。会立即执行,保证成交,但可能出现滑点。
适用场景: 风险管理和策略交易。用于在预设的价格水平自动止损或止盈,无需持续监控市场。
二、 优化网络连接
网络连接的质量是加密货币交易成败的关键因素之一,它直接影响订单的发送、接收以及执行的速度。延迟越高,交易滑点和错失交易机会的风险就越大。因此,优化网络连接是提升交易效率、降低潜在损失的必要措施。
- 选择稳定的网络环境: 确保所使用的网络连接具备高稳定性和快速的数据传输速率。应尽量避免使用公共Wi-Fi热点等不稳定的网络,这些网络往往由于用户数量过多、带宽受限等原因,容易导致延迟、数据包丢失甚至连接中断,从而影响交易的及时性和准确性。家庭宽带或专线网络是更可靠的选择。
- 有线连接优于无线连接: 尽可能选择有线连接(例如通过以太网电缆连接)而非无线连接(Wi-Fi)。有线连接通常提供更稳定、更快速的网络连接,因为它避免了无线信号干扰、信号衰减等问题,从而减少延迟和数据包丢失的可能性。对于追求极致速度和稳定性的高频交易者,有线连接是首选方案。
- 关闭不必要的应用程序: 关闭所有不必要的、可能占用网络带宽的应用程序和进程,例如视频流媒体服务(如YouTube、Netflix)、大型文件下载软件(如BitTorrent)以及在线游戏等。这些应用程序会消耗大量的网络带宽,导致交易软件可用的带宽减少,从而影响交易的速度和响应时间。在进行交易时,尽量保持网络环境的简洁,只运行必要的交易软件。
- 使用VPN(虚拟专用网络): 在某些情况下,使用VPN可以显著改善网络连接的稳定性和速度,尤其是在网络环境受到限制或者需要连接到地理位置距离交易所服务器较远的地区时。VPN通过建立加密隧道,可以绕过网络拥塞、防火墙限制和地理位置限制,从而提高网络连接的质量。选择延迟较低、信誉良好的VPN服务提供商,并确保VPN服务器的地理位置靠近交易所服务器,以减少额外的延迟。需要注意的是,使用VPN可能涉及隐私和安全问题,务必选择可信赖的服务商并了解其隐私政策。
三、 调整交易设置
欧易平台提供一系列交易设置,这些设置能够显著影响订单的执行效率和最终成交价格,合理配置这些参数对于提升交易体验至关重要。
- 快速下单功能: 启用欧易平台的快速下单功能。这项功能允许交易者直接通过点击盘口的价格档位,无需手动输入价格即可迅速提交订单。通过减少手动操作步骤,快速下单功能显著提升下单速度,尤其适用于瞬息万变的市场行情中,帮助用户抓住交易机会。
- 预设交易数量: 预先配置常用的交易数量,可以选择固定数量的数字货币,或者设定为账户总资金的一定百分比。例如,可以将交易数量预设为1个比特币或账户资金的10%。通过预设交易数量,用户可以避免每次下单时都手动输入交易数量的繁琐步骤,从而节省宝贵的交易时间,提高交易效率。
- 调整滑点容忍度: 针对市价单等特定类型的订单,交易者可以设置滑点容忍度。滑点是指实际成交价格与下单时预期价格之间的差异。在市场波动剧烈时,滑点现象尤为常见。设置合理的滑点容忍度,允许订单在一定范围内以略高于或低于预期价格成交,从而提高订单的成交概率,避免因价格波动而导致订单无法成交的情况。需要注意的是,设置过高的滑点容忍度可能会导致最终成交价格与预期价格产生较大偏差,用户需根据自身风险承受能力和市场情况谨慎设置。
四、 利用API交易
对于追求极致交易效率的高频交易者以及需要精密自动化交易策略的用户,利用欧易交易所提供的API(应用程序编程接口)是提升订单执行速度和实现复杂策略的强大工具。API绕过了传统网页界面的限制,直接与交易所的交易引擎交互,显著降低延迟。
- API优势: API允许开发者以编程方式直接连接至欧易的交易系统核心,无需通过用户界面。这种直接连接能够显著降低交易延迟,因为避免了用户界面带来的额外处理步骤,使得订单可以更快地提交和执行。更低的延迟对于捕捉快速变化的市场机会至关重要。
- 定制化交易策略: 通过API,用户可以根据自身需求和风险偏好,编写高度定制化的交易策略。常见的策略包括但不限于:自动止盈止损(根据预设价格自动平仓以锁定利润或限制损失)、网格交易(在特定价格区间内自动挂单,通过价格波动赚取差价)、套利交易(同时在不同市场买入和卖出相同资产以获取价格差异利润)、以及趋势跟踪策略(根据市场趋势自动调整仓位)。这些策略可以全天候自动运行,无需人工干预,极大地提高了交易效率和盈利潜力。
- 选择合适的编程语言: 在使用API进行交易时,编程语言的选择至关重要。Python因其易用性和丰富的库(如`ccxt`、`requests`等)而广受欢迎,适合快速开发和原型验证。然而,对于对性能有极致要求的场景,例如高频交易,C++或Go等编译型语言可能更合适。这些语言能够提供更高的执行效率和更低的资源占用,从而降低交易延迟。Java也是一个不错的选择,拥有成熟的生态和良好的性能。
- 优化API代码: 编写高效的API代码是确保交易速度的关键。这包括但不限于:最小化API请求频率(避免不必要的请求)、使用批量订单提交(将多个订单合并为一个请求)、优化数据处理逻辑(避免不必要的计算)、以及使用高效的数据结构(如避免不必要的字符串操作)。采用异步编程模型可以提高并发处理能力,使得程序能够同时处理多个请求,进一步提高交易速度。代码的有效管理和适当的错误处理同样重要,以确保交易系统的稳定性和可靠性。
五、 关注市场流动性和深度
市场流动性和深度是影响订单执行速度和交易成本的关键因素。它们反映了市场参与者的活跃程度和交易的便捷性。
- 流动性好的交易对: 选择流动性强的交易对是优化交易执行的首要步骤。 高流动性意味着市场存在大量的买单和卖单,订单更容易以期望的价格快速成交。 低流动性可能导致滑点增大,甚至无法成交,特别是对于大额订单。
- 观察深度图: 在提交订单前,仔细分析订单簿的深度图。 深度图直观地展示了不同价格水平上的买盘(bid)和卖盘(ask)数量。 了解深度图可以帮助你评估特定价格的订单是否容易被快速执行,并避免在深度较浅(订单量少)的价格档位下单,因为这些档位的订单容易被其他交易者抢先成交,导致更高的成交价格或无法成交。 深度图也可以揭示市场支撑位和阻力位,为交易决策提供依据。
- 避免在市场波动剧烈时下单: 市场剧烈波动时期,订单执行速度常常会受到影响。 价格快速变动可能导致订单以与预期价格相差甚远的价格成交,即滑点。 在波动剧烈的时期,交易平台也可能出现拥堵,延迟订单执行。 尽量避免在此期间下单,如果必须交易,考虑使用限价单来精确控制成交价格。 设定限价单后,只有当市场价格达到或优于设定的价格时,订单才会被执行。
六、 深入了解手续费机制
欧易等加密货币交易平台的手续费机制直接影响订单的撮合优先级和最终的交易成本。理解这些机制对于优化交易策略至关重要。
- Maker和Taker: 欧易遵循典型的Maker-Taker手续费模型。Maker (挂单者) 通过限价单在订单簿上增加流动性,他们的订单不会立即成交,而是等待其他用户来匹配。Taker (吃单者) 则通过市价单或立即成交的限价单移除订单簿上的流动性,与订单簿上现有的订单进行交易。
- Maker手续费优势: 为了鼓励用户提供流动性,Maker手续费通常显著低于Taker手续费。选择挂单成为Maker,不仅能降低交易成本,在某些情况下,还能享受负手续费,即平台返还部分交易费用。因此,如果你的交易策略允许,尽量选择成为Maker,这有助于提升订单的潜在执行优先级,尤其是在市场波动较小的时候。
- 手续费等级与VIP制度: 欧易和其他交易所普遍采用分层手续费制度,用户的交易量、持有的平台币数量或其他特定条件决定其手续费等级。交易量越大、等级越高,手续费率越低。VIP等级的提升不仅降低了交易成本,也可能影响订单的优先级。例如,某些平台会给予VIP用户更快的API请求频率或更优先的订单处理权。持续交易并努力提升VIP等级,是从手续费角度提升交易效率的有效途径。平台还可能不定期推出手续费优惠活动,关注这些活动也能有效降低交易成本。
七、 硬件设备的选择
尽管软件层面的优化至关重要,硬件设备的性能对于提升交易执行速度同样具有显著影响。选择合适的硬件配置,能够为高频交易、量化交易等对延迟敏感的交易策略提供坚实的基础。
- 高性能电脑: 选择配备高性能中央处理器(CPU)和充足内存(RAM)的电脑至关重要。CPU的运算速度直接影响交易软件的响应速度和订单处理效率。多核处理器能够更好地处理多线程任务,例如同时运行多个交易终端或复杂的量化模型。推荐选择具有较高主频和较多核心数的CPU。大容量的RAM(至少16GB,建议32GB或更高)能够确保交易软件在运行过程中有足够的内存空间,避免因内存不足而导致的卡顿和延迟。
- 高速固态硬盘 (SSD): 传统的机械硬盘(HDD)在数据读取和写入速度上远不如固态硬盘。使用SSD可以显著缩短交易软件的启动时间、行情数据的加载时间以及订单的写入时间。考虑到交易数据量可能会很大,建议选择容量较大的SSD,以保证有足够的存储空间。NVMe SSD相较于SATA SSD具有更快的传输速度,在高频交易等场景下能够带来更佳的性能表现。
- 多个显示器: 多显示器配置能够显著提升交易效率。通过多个显示器,交易者可以同时监控不同市场的行情数据、技术指标、订单簿深度等信息,而无需频繁切换窗口。这使得交易者能够更快地捕捉市场机会,并做出更及时的交易决策。建议选择分辨率较高的显示器,以提供更清晰的视觉体验。考虑使用显示器支架,方便调整显示器的角度和高度,以获得更舒适的观看体验。
八、持续学习和实践
加密货币市场具有极高的波动性和快速变化的特点,因此,提升在欧易平台上的订单执行速度是一个需要持续学习和实践的过程。只有紧跟市场动态,不断优化交易策略,才能在这个竞争激烈的市场中获得优势。
- 关注欧易官方公告: 欧易官方公告是了解平台最新动态、规则变更和技术升级的重要渠道。密切关注官方公告,可以及时掌握交易规则的调整、手续费政策的变动以及平台推出的新功能。这些信息对于优化交易策略和提高订单执行速度至关重要。
- 参与社区讨论: 加入加密货币交易社区,与其他交易者交流经验和技巧,是提升交易技能的有效途径。通过社区讨论,可以了解不同交易者的策略、遇到的问题以及解决方案。这种交流可以拓宽视野,帮助你发现自身交易策略的不足,并学习新的交易技巧。
- 不断测试和优化: 交易策略和平台设置并非一成不变,需要根据市场变化和个人经验不断测试和优化。通过模拟交易或小额实盘交易,测试不同参数和策略的效果,并根据测试结果进行调整。只有不断优化,才能找到最适合自己的交易方式,最大限度地提高订单执行速度和交易效率。
提升在欧易平台上的订单执行速度需要综合考虑多个因素,包括选择合适的订单类型(限价单、市价单等)、优化网络连接、调整交易设置、合理使用API接口(如有)、关注市场流动性、了解手续费机制以及升级硬件设备等。这些因素相互影响,共同决定了订单的执行速度。通过对这些因素的深入理解和不断优化,可以在加密货币交易中获得更大的竞争优势。例如,选择更快的网络连接,可以减少网络延迟,从而提高订单发送速度。使用更快的硬件设备,可以加速交易数据的处理,从而提高订单执行效率。深入了解市场流动性,可以在流动性好的时候进行交易,从而提高订单成交概率和速度。